body{
		font-family:Verdana, Arial, Helvetica, sans-serif;
		color:#fff;	
		background-image:url(../images/bg.jpg);
		}

#ausgabebereich{
		margin: 1px auto;
		width: 998px;
		height: 670px;
		background-color:#fff;
		}
		
#grau{ 
		position:absolute;
		margin-left:20px;
		margin-top:2px;	 
		width:957px; 
		height:571px;
      	z-index:10; 
		background-color:#ddd;
		}
		
		
		
/* textfeld ist Inhaltsbereich der Unterseiten */

#textfeld{
		position:absolute; 
		top:162px; 	
		left:15px; 
		padding:10px;
		width:630px; 
		height:374px;
		background-color:#888;
		z-index:30; 
		overflow:auto; 		
		}		

#textfeld a:link, #textfeld a:visited, #textfeld a:active,
#projektfeld a:link, #projektfeld a:visited, #projektfeld a:active
		{
		font-size:11px;
		font-weight:normal;
		text-decoration:underline;
		color:#000;
		}		
		
#textfeld a:hover, #projektfeld a:hover
		{
		font-size:11px;
		font-weight:normal;
		text-decoration:underline;
		color:#fff;
		}



.filmbildquadrat{
		float:left;
		width:73px;
		height:73px;
		background-color:#CCCCCC;
		margin-bottom:5px;
		margin-top:10px;
		margin-right:10px;
		z-index:100;
		border:0;
		}		
	
.fliesstext ul{
		list-style-position:outside;
		list-style-type:square;
		margin-left:-7px;
		}	
	
	
	
/* .orange sind die drei Menuefelder */
.orange{
		position:absolute;
 		background-color:#d25502;
 		width:650px; 
		height:130px;
		margin-left:15px;
		color:#396;
		}
		
.orange a{
		color:#066;
		}		

.orange span{
		color:#fff;
		}
		
.orange .text{
		position:absolute;
		bottom:23px;
		left:90px;	
		}
		
.orange .text a:hover{
		color:#0C9;
		}		
		
.orange .titel{
		font-weight:bold;
		font-size:18px;
		display:block;	
		}
		
.orange .subnav{
		font-weight:normal;
		font-size:13px;
		display:block;
		}

.roundCorner{
		background-image:url(../images/corner.gif);
		background-repeat:no-repeat;
		background-position:right top;
		}
		
.box1{
		margin-top:162px;
		}
		
.box2{
		margin-top:294px;
		}

.box3{
		margin-top:426px;
		}

.box4{
		margin-top:30px;
		}
		
a.orange .quadrat, .quadrat{
		float:left;
		width:30px;
		height:30px;
		background-color:#000;
		margin-left:30px;
		margin-top:74px;
		z-index:100;
		}

a.orange:hover .quadrat,
a.orange:focus .quadrat{
		background-color:#888;
		}

a.orange:hover .titel,
a.orange:focus .titel,
a.orange:hover .subtitel,
a.orange:focus .subtitel{
		color:#000;
		}

		
a:link, a:visited, a:active
		{
		font-size:10px;
		text-decoration:none;
		color:#d25502;
		}		
							
a:hover{
		font-weight:bold;
		text-decoration:none;
		color:#fff;
		}
	
	
		
		
#bild, #bildmenue, #bildkontakt, #bildconcepts, #bildreferenzen, #bildprofil, #bildimpressum
		{ 
		position:absolute;	
		top:294px; 
		right:15px; 
		width:262px; 
		height:262px;
		}
		
#bildmenue{ 	
		background-image:url(../images/bildmenue.jpg);
		}
		
#bildkontakt{ 	
		background-image:url(../images/bildkontakt.jpg);
		}
		
#bildprofil{ 	
		background-image:url(../images/bildprofil.jpg);
		}		
		
#bildreferenzen{ 	
		background-image:url(../images/bildreferenzen.jpg);
		}	

#bildconcepts{ 	
		background-image:url(../images/bildleistungen.jpg);
		}			
	
	


#flashfilm, #quadrat
		{ 
		position:absolute;	
		top:294px; 
		right:15px; 
		width:262px; 
		height:262px;
		}

					
							
.subtitel{
		font-size:13px;
		font-weight:normal;
		line-height:15px;
		}		

.headline{
		font-size:14px;
		font-weight:bold;
		line-height:16px;
		}	
		
.subline{
		display:block;
		font-size:12px;
		font-weight:bold;
		}
			
.fliesstext{
		display:block;
		font-size:11px;
		line-height:14px;
		font-weight:normal;
		}






#navigation{
		position:absolute;
		margin-top:574px;	 
		width:957px; 
		height:45px;
		background-color:#fff; 	
		z-index:130;
		}

#eins, #sechs, #acht, #sieben{
		position:absolute;
		background-color:#ddd;
		margin-top:0px;
		height:45px;
		z-index:131;
		}
				
		
#eins{
		margin-left:0px;
		width:15px;
		}		

#zwei a:link, #zwei a:active, #zwei a:visited, #zwei a:hover
		{
		margin-left:18px;
		width:77px;
		}

#drei a:link, #drei a:active, #drei a:visited, #drei a:hover{
		margin-left:104px;
		width:77px;
		}
	
#vier a:link, #vier a:active, #vier a:visited, #vier a:hover
		{
		margin-left:190px;
		width:77px;
		}
		
#fuenf a:link, #fuenf a:active, #fuenf a:visited, #fuenf a:hover
		{
		margin-left:276px;
		width:77px;
		}	
		
#sechs{
		margin-left:362px;
		width:315px;
		}


#sieben, #sieben a:link, #sieben a:active, #sieben a:visited, #sieben a:hover{
		margin-left:680px;
		width:259px;		
		}
		
#acht{
		margin-left:942px;
		width:15px;
		}		
		
#zwei a:link, #zwei a:active, #zwei a:visited,
#drei a:link, #drei a:active, #drei a:visited,
#vier a:link, #vier a:active, #vier a:visited,
#fuenf a:link, #fuenf a:active, #fuenf a:visited,
#sieben a:link, #sieben a:active, #sieben a:visited
		{
		position:absolute;
		background:#ddd;
		height:39px;
		padding:3px;
		z-index:131;
		}
		
#zwei a:hover, #drei a:hover, #vier a:hover, #fuenf a:hover, #sieben a:hover
		{
		background:#d25502;
		}				
		
		
		
		

			

		

